fix:1.调整表格细节样式 2.添加请求入参
This commit is contained in:
@@ -60,7 +60,7 @@
|
||||
|
||||
<script>
|
||||
import { api } from '@/utils/api'
|
||||
import { dateFormatByAppearance } from '@/utils/date-util'
|
||||
import { dateFormatByAppearance, getSecond } from '@/utils/date-util'
|
||||
import { get } from '@/utils/http'
|
||||
import chartMixin from '@/views/charts2/chart-mixin'
|
||||
|
||||
@@ -68,7 +68,8 @@ export default {
|
||||
name: 'DnsActiveMaliciousDomain',
|
||||
data () {
|
||||
return {
|
||||
tableData: [],
|
||||
tableData: [], // 表格数据
|
||||
// 表头数据
|
||||
customTableTitles: [
|
||||
{
|
||||
label: 'dns.domain',
|
||||
@@ -95,7 +96,7 @@ export default {
|
||||
prop: 'lastSeenTime'
|
||||
}
|
||||
],
|
||||
isNoData: false
|
||||
isNoData: false // 无数据标识,true为无数据,false有数据
|
||||
}
|
||||
},
|
||||
mixins: [chartMixin],
|
||||
@@ -112,7 +113,20 @@ export default {
|
||||
},
|
||||
methods: {
|
||||
initData () {
|
||||
get(api.dnsInsight.activeMaliciousDomain).then(res => {
|
||||
this.toggleLoading(true)
|
||||
|
||||
this.tableData = []
|
||||
|
||||
const params = {
|
||||
startTime: getSecond(this.timeFilter.startTime),
|
||||
endTime: getSecond(this.timeFilter.endTime),
|
||||
limit: 8,
|
||||
type: this.tableType,
|
||||
severity: this.tableSeverity
|
||||
}
|
||||
console.log('DnsActiveMaliciousDomain.vue--initData--请求入参', this.timeFilter)
|
||||
|
||||
get(api.dnsInsight.activeMaliciousDomain, params).then(res => {
|
||||
console.log('DnsActiveMaliciousDomain.vue--initData--初始化数据', res.data)
|
||||
if (res.code === 200) {
|
||||
const data = res.data.result
|
||||
|
||||
Reference in New Issue
Block a user